8.             Extended TermsSection 2.4 of the Lease is amended to delete the second paragraph therefrom in its entirety and to replace it with the following:

 

If and to the extent Tenant shall exercise the foregoing options to extend the Term, the first Extended Term shall commence on January 1, 2030 and expire on December 31, 2044 and the second Extended Term shall commence on January 1, January 1, 2045 and expire on December 31, 2059.  All of the terms, covenants and provisions of this Agreement shall apply to each Extended Term, except that (x) the Minimum Rent payable during such Extended Term shall be the greater of the Prior Rent and the Fair Market Value Rent for the Leased Property (such Fair Market Value Rent to be determined by agreement of the parties or, absent agreement, by an appraiser designated by Landlord) (taking into account that the Initial Base Year and the 2019 Base Year, as applicable, shall remain unchanged) and (y) Tenant shall have no right to extend the Term beyond December 31, 2059.  For purposes of this Section 2.4, “Prior Rent” shall mean an amount equal to the per annum Minimum Rent in effect on the last day of the Fixed Term or Extended Term immediately preceding such Extended Term.  If Tenant shall elect to exercise the option to extend the Term for the first Extended Term, it shall do so by giving Landlord Notice thereof not later than December 31, 2028, and if Tenant shall elect to exercise its option to extend the Term for the second Extended Term after having elected to extend the Term for the first Extended Term, it shall do so by giving Landlord Notice not later than December 31, 2043, it being understood and agreed that time shall be of the essence with respect to the giving of any such Notice.  If Tenant shall fail to give any such Notice, this Agreement shall automatically terminate at the end of the Fixed Term or the first Extended Term as applicable and Tenant shall have no further option to extend the Term of this Agreement.  If Tenant shall give such Notice, the extension of this Agreement shall be automatically effected without the execution of any additional documents; it being understood and agreed, however, that Tenant and Landlord shall execute such documents and agreements as either party shall reasonably require to evidence the same.  Notwithstanding the provisions of the foregoing sentence, if, subsequent to the giving of such Notice, an Event of Default shall occur, at Landlord’s option, the extension of this Agreement shall cease to take effect and this Agreement shall automatically terminate at the end of the Fixed Term or the first Extended Term, as applicable, and Tenant shall have no further option to extend the Term of this Agreement.

 

9.             Additional RentSection 3.1.2(a) of the Lease is amended by deleting the first sentence therefrom in its entirety and replacing it with the following:

 

Tenant shall pay additional rent (“Additional Rent”) with respect to each Lease Year (or portion thereof) during the Term subsequent to the Initial Base Year, with respect to each Property, in an amount equal to three percent (3%) of the amount by which Gross Revenues at such Property during such Lease Year exceed Gross Revenues at such Property during the Initial Base Year (or the equivalent portion thereof).  In addition, Tenant shall pay Additional Rent with respect to each Lease Year (or portion thereof) during the Term subsequent to the

 

3


 

2019 Base Year, with respect to each Property, in an amount equal to one-half percent (0.5%) of the amount by which Gross Revenues at such Property during such Lease Year exceed Gross Revenues at such Property during the 2019 Base Year (or the equivalent portion thereof).  For the avoidance of doubt, the payment of Additional Rent based on Gross Revenues in excess of Gross Revenues for the Initial Base Year and the payment of Additional Rent based on Gross Revenues in excess of Gross Revenues for the 2019 Base Year are separate and independent obligations.
